Background: Husband and wife Jeff and Sarah Tackett and their band, Powell Creek Junction, carry on a long tradition of tight harmonies in music ministry. Jeff’s been singing and touring since the age of eight with his family's gospel group, “The Tackett Family.”As a preacher's kid, he toured the US from their home in Shelby, OH, to share their music ministry from 1979 to 1994, followed by a solo country career. Jeff’s rich country vocals are the perfect blend with Sarah’s tender voice that touches the heart and spirit.Sarah, a former Miss Ohio and talent award winner in the Miss America Pageant, has a background in musical theater, TV and radio commercials, and voice-overs. She's been a featured speaker and emcee for special events and women's conferences.The Tacketts live in Defiance, OH, have four children, and travel with their six talented band members.
